How to Make a Handmade Crib

    • 1). Use a tape measure and framing square to measure and mark cut lines on 2-by-2-inch pine lumber for four pieces, 18 inches in length. Measure and mark cut lines on 3/4-inch plywood for three pieces, two of them at 34-by-30 inches and one at 58-by-34 inches. Use a circular saw to cut the 2-by-2s and 3/4-inch plywood pieces.

    • 2). Use two L-brackets on each of the 2-by-2-inch pieces to attach them vertically at the inside of the four corners of the 58-by-34-inch piece of plywood, with their outside edges 2 inches away from the edges of the plywood -- i.e., make them inset instead of at the edge of the plywood.

    • 3). Sit the base assembly of the crib upright, with the plywood mattress base over the four crib legs. Use the tape measure, framing square and straightedge to draw a vertical line on the upper surface of the 58-by-34-inch plywood base, along the long axis and 3/4-inch in from the edge. Repeat this procedure, drawing an identical line on the other side. Measure and mark an identical set of 18 drill holes on each of these lines, 3 inches apart starting at a point 3 inches from the end.

    • 4). Use a power drill to drill 3/4-inch holes 1/2-inch deep at all 36 drill holes.

    • 5). Measure and use a jigsaw to cut 36 pieces of 3/4-inch pine doweling 31 inches in length.

    • 6). Measure and cut two 1-by-2-inch pieces of pine lumber for the top rails on the sides. Cut them with a circular saw. Lay each of them on a flat surface, then draw a centerline along the upper, flat and long axes of the pieces. Measure and mark the same 18 drill holes with the same size and locations as the holes on the mattress base. Drill 3/4-inch holes 1/2-inch deep at all the drill marks.

    • 7). Hold one of the 34-by-30-inch pieces of plywood with its 34-inch side on top, and place it on the end of the 58-by-34-inch mattress base. Mark, drill and drive 3/4-inch wood screws through L-brackets to attach the end panel to the mattress base. Repeat this process on the other end. Invert the assembly and drill four 1-inch holes, 3/8 inches in from the edge -- i.e., centered in the width of the side panel -- and 7 inches apart along the connecting edges of the end panel and the base.

    • 8). Apply construction glue to one end of the pieces of doweling, and insert them into the holes in the top rail. Repeat this process on the other top rail.

    • 9). Invert the top rail assembly and apply construction glue to each of the dowels. Insert the pieces of dowel into glue-applied holes in the mattress base. When fully inserted, the ends of the top rails should be resting squarely on the top surface of the end panels of the crib. Repeat this process on the other top rail assembly.

      Use a wood rasp and sandpaper to clean up and smooth all the edges of the crib. Use wood putty to smooth out the plywood cuts. Prime and paint or stain and varnish all the surfaces.
